JPMorgan US Quality Factor ETF

435 hedge funds and large institutions have $5.17B invested in JPMorgan US Quality Factor ETF in 2025 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 67 funds opening new positions, 169 increasing their positions, 150 reducing their positions, and 30 closing their positions.
